About the Role

You will be responsible for providing support for all of our clients across the range of work carried out by the Team, including company and commercial work, procurement, major projects, information governance and corporate governance. You will need to demonstrate an aptitude for complex problem solving and the ability to work quickly and accurately, as part of a friendly and supportive team. You need to be willing to learn and adapt to the challenging legal environment in the public sector. 

You should be a fully qualified practising solicitor or barrister with experience in contract and commercial law.

As part of being a Disability Confident employer we guarantee to interview anyone with a disability whose application meets the minimum criteria for the post. By ‘minimum criteria’ we mean that you must provide us with evidence in your application form which demonstrates that you generally meet the level of competence required for each competence, as well as meeting any of the qualifications, skills or experience defined as essential in the person specification.
